Default iPod Touch Gen2 (The Funnest iPod Ever)



I have an iPod Touch Gen1 and I've opted not to upgrade. The only real difference is that this newer version has volume buttons on the left top side. Plus it has a mini speaker so that you can't play games and or listen to podcast or even music (this speaker is only for very casual listening). The design is a little sleeker and of course they did drop the prices on the 8, 16 and 32gb versions, ranging from $229 to $399.

The recent release of the 2.1 software basically gave all use IPT Gen 1 owners the same features as the Gen2. An example is Genius, with just a few taps, the new Genius feature creates a playlist of tracks in your library that go great together. I really like this feature and find I use it a great deal.

To be honest I basically use my IPT as a PDA. It allows me to track my apointments, schedule events/meetings, receive and respond to my email, check my stocks, find out what the weather is doing and even look up phone numbers, zip codes and with Google maps it even allows me to figure out where I am and how to get where I am going.

The applications available have really enhanced the useability of the IPT. Being a music nut, I really have enjoyed the AOL, Pandora applications. But those are only a couple out of about 10 that I have installed. On the weekends I track NFL and NCAA Football games with updated stats and the almost live play by play action is really sweet.

Now the only draw back to all this fun, you must have a wifi connection. Fortunately for me almost everywhere I go I have a wifi connection so this device works out well in my day to day walk through life.

Now if they come out with a 64g IPT gen 2 or 3, I am on it!
